Handover: Exportron retry queue

Hi Mira — handing over the failed-export retries. Exports that hit a timeout land in the retry queue and get three attempts with backoff; after that they're parked and need a manual requeue from the admin panel. Watch for customers reporting duplicates — that usually means a double requeue. The current retry settings are as follows.

settings of bajog-fawig:
oliael:
  log_level: warn
  metrics_host: metrics.oliael.zemvarsys.internal
  pin: 0267
  pool_size: 32

// CATALOG_CACHE_TTL_SECONDS
//
// Invalidation for the Pricklepine product catalog is event-driven,
// not TTL-driven. This TTL is a backstop only. Do NOT lower it to
// "fix" stale listings — stale listings mean the invalidation bus
// dropped an event, and masking that with a short TTL hides the bug
// and hammers the origin. We learned this twice. Fix the bus consumer
// instead. Verified against the build with the token below.

pipeline stamp: htk31_f769b577b3028a4e9958e5bb8d1259a

Ticket: Spreadsheet export job failing on Gridwell staging

Welcome aboard — context first. The Gridwell export worker streams large spreadsheets to keep memory flat, but since Tuesday every run dies with a 401 before streaming even starts. The service credential for the Cellforge API expired over the weekend, which is why memory profiling now shows nothing useful. Platform ops minted a replacement this morning. Use the new key below when re-running the profiler.

API key for yahig-tadup: kto7_ubizbYm